Heart rate training is a valuable tool for both athletes and those looking to improve their health. It helps you optimise your workouts and recovery, by converting heart rate metrics into easy-to-understand heart rate zones that are different for everyone. Heart rate training is completely tailored to you As heart rate training is based on your personal demographics; age, gender, and maximum heart rate, you can be certain the training plan is suitable for you. Quantify how hard you’re working Heart rate training is a great way to make sure that you are working hard enough, or not overdoing it during your workout. It allows you to easily adjust the intensity of a session so that you can get the most out of it. This means less time wasted, so more time spent training effectively. Effectively drive performance Heart rate training is an excellent way to improve your fitness and performance. The most obvious overall benefit of heart rate training is that it helps you build endurance. By monitoring your heart rate and keeping it within a specific range, you can gradually increase how long you can exercise before fatigue sets in. Heart rate training also gives athletes a way to measure their progress over time as they work towards achieving their goals.
